British and French amphibious assault craft take part in Exercise Corsican Lion.
Elements of 3 Commando Brigade Royal Marines conducted a WADER training package on the French Island of Corsica.
The exercise saw British servicemen, train alongside their French counterparts in amphibious landing techniques from British craft and French craft. The training took place off Solenzaro Beach in Corsica as part of Exercise Corsican Lion.
Corsican Lion provides the first major naval exercise that examines and tests the Maritime element of the Combined Joint Expeditionary Force by demonstrating its ability to project power from the sea
